[發(fā)明專利]一種路由調(diào)度方法、裝置及網(wǎng)絡(luò)設(shè)備有效
| 申請(qǐng)?zhí)枺?/td> | 201310474001.5 | 申請(qǐng)日: | 2013-10-11 |
| 公開(公告)號(hào): | CN103532852B | 公開(公告)日: | 2017-12-19 |
| 發(fā)明(設(shè)計(jì))人: | 尹家進(jìn);樊家麟;屈恒 | 申請(qǐng)(專利權(quán))人: | 小米科技有限責(zé)任公司 |
| 主分類號(hào): | H04L12/741 | 分類號(hào): | H04L12/741;H04L29/12 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 100085 北京市海淀區(qū)清*** | 國(guó)省代碼: | 北京;11 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 路由 調(diào)度 方法 裝置 網(wǎng)絡(luò)設(shè)備 | ||
技術(shù)領(lǐng)域
本公開是關(guān)于計(jì)算機(jī)及通信技術(shù)領(lǐng)域,尤其是關(guān)于一種路由調(diào)度方法、裝置及網(wǎng)絡(luò)設(shè)備。
背景技術(shù)
互聯(lián)網(wǎng)是將兩臺(tái)計(jì)算機(jī)或者是兩臺(tái)以上的計(jì)算機(jī)終端、客戶端、服務(wù)端通過計(jì)算機(jī)信息技術(shù)的手段互相聯(lián)系起來的結(jié)果,人們可以與遠(yuǎn)在千里之外的朋友相互發(fā)送郵件、共同完成一項(xiàng)工作、共同娛樂。
互聯(lián)網(wǎng)中的一個(gè)重要設(shè)備就是路由器。路由器(Router)是連接因特網(wǎng)中各局域網(wǎng)、廣域網(wǎng)的設(shè)備,它的主要工作就是為經(jīng)過路由器的每個(gè)數(shù)據(jù)幀尋找一條最佳傳輸路徑,并將該數(shù)據(jù)有效地傳送到目的站點(diǎn)。由此可見,選擇最佳路徑的策略即路由算法是路由器的關(guān)鍵所在。為了完成這項(xiàng)工作,在路由器中保存著各種傳輸路徑的相關(guān)數(shù)據(jù),即路由表(Routing Table)供路由選擇時(shí)使用。打個(gè)比方來說,路由表就像我們平時(shí)使用的地圖一樣,標(biāo)識(shí)各種路線,路由表中保存著子網(wǎng)的標(biāo)志信息、網(wǎng)上路由器的個(gè)數(shù)和下一個(gè)路由器的名字等內(nèi)容。路由表可以是由系統(tǒng)管理員固定設(shè)置好的,也可以由系統(tǒng)動(dòng)態(tài)修改,可以由路由器自動(dòng)調(diào)整,也可以由主機(jī)控制。
相關(guān)技術(shù)中,對(duì)于家庭里的無線路由器(一種可以用于家庭環(huán)境下連接互聯(lián)網(wǎng)的設(shè)備,通過無線保真WIFI發(fā)射技術(shù)讓家庭中其他WIFI設(shè)備不要網(wǎng)線即可聯(lián)網(wǎng)),預(yù)先設(shè)置路由器中的路由以及每個(gè)路由的流量分配額,將總流量分別分配到相應(yīng)的線路上,該路由器流量調(diào)度方法中的路由采用靜態(tài)設(shè)置(由系統(tǒng)管理員固定設(shè)置),對(duì)于互聯(lián)網(wǎng)協(xié)議第四版IPv4地址,乃至互聯(lián)網(wǎng)協(xié)議第六版IPv6地址數(shù)量巨大的互聯(lián)網(wǎng)環(huán)境,將會(huì)導(dǎo)致效率低下、管理不便、調(diào)度不精準(zhǔn)的問題。因此,如何解決復(fù)雜環(huán)境下靜態(tài)路由進(jìn)行流量調(diào)度帶來的效率低下、管理不便、調(diào)度不精準(zhǔn)問題成為目前亟待解決的技術(shù)問題。
發(fā)明內(nèi)容
為克服相關(guān)技術(shù)中存在的問題,本公開提供一種路由調(diào)度方法、裝置及網(wǎng)絡(luò)設(shè)備,在靜態(tài)路由的基礎(chǔ)上增加動(dòng)態(tài)調(diào)整,又不完全等同動(dòng)態(tài)路由,尤其適合家庭路由系統(tǒng),提高流量調(diào)度的效率,且方便管理。
一方面,本公開提供了一種路由調(diào)度方法,包括:
接收域名解析請(qǐng)求,從所述域名解析請(qǐng)求中獲取域名;
當(dāng)所述域名屬于域名列表時(shí),獲取所述域名對(duì)應(yīng)的IP地址;
將所述IP地址加入到當(dāng)前路由表中形成目標(biāo)路由表;
對(duì)所述目標(biāo)路由表進(jìn)行流量調(diào)度處理,獲得所述IP地址對(duì)應(yīng)的路由。
本公開中,通過判斷域名是否屬于預(yù)置的域名列表(該域名列表中的域名,是需要采用本公開的動(dòng)態(tài)調(diào)度方法進(jìn)行流量調(diào)度的域名),當(dāng)域名屬于預(yù)置的域名列表時(shí),說明該域名需要采用本公開的動(dòng)態(tài)調(diào)度方法進(jìn)行流量調(diào)度,從而可將該域名對(duì)應(yīng)的IP地址動(dòng)態(tài)加入到當(dāng)前路由表中形成目標(biāo)路由表,對(duì)目標(biāo)路由表進(jìn)行流量調(diào)度處理,進(jìn)而獲得IP地址對(duì)應(yīng)的路由,從而實(shí)現(xiàn)精確快速的路由調(diào)度,提高了調(diào)度效率,更適應(yīng)家庭路由系統(tǒng)。
所述方法還包括:
當(dāng)所述域名不屬于所述域名列表時(shí),獲取所述域名對(duì)應(yīng)的IP地址;
獲得預(yù)設(shè)的所述IP地址對(duì)應(yīng)的路由。
本公開中,當(dāng)該域名不屬于預(yù)置的域名列表時(shí),依然按照目前的靜態(tài)調(diào)度策略為該域名分配路由。
所述對(duì)所述目標(biāo)路由表進(jìn)行流量調(diào)度處理,獲得所述IP地址對(duì)應(yīng)的路由,包括:
根據(jù)域名類別對(duì)應(yīng)的路由選擇規(guī)則,對(duì)所述目標(biāo)路由表進(jìn)行流量調(diào)度處理;
獲得所述IP地址對(duì)應(yīng)的路由。
本公開提供了一種對(duì)目標(biāo)路由表進(jìn)行流量調(diào)度處理的方法。
所述獲得所述IP地址對(duì)應(yīng)的路由之后,所述方法還包括:
統(tǒng)計(jì)目標(biāo)路由表中預(yù)設(shè)時(shí)長(zhǎng)內(nèi)未使用的路由;
從目標(biāo)路由表中清除所述預(yù)設(shè)時(shí)長(zhǎng)內(nèi)未使用的路由。
本公開中,可以根據(jù)過期策略,將一定時(shí)間內(nèi)未使用過的路由清除,降低路由數(shù)量,從而降低調(diào)度成本,提高網(wǎng)絡(luò)設(shè)備的運(yùn)行效率。
所述接收域名解析請(qǐng)求之前,所述方法還包括:
獲取用戶設(shè)置的所述域名列表;或者
根據(jù)預(yù)設(shè)的數(shù)據(jù)挖掘算法生成所述域名列表;或者
獲取外部程序生成的所述域名列表。
本公開提供了多種獲取或生成域名列表的方法。
另一方面,本公開提供了一種路由調(diào)度裝置,包括:
確定模塊,用于接收域名解析請(qǐng)求,從所述域名解析請(qǐng)求中獲取域名;
第一獲取模塊,用于當(dāng)所述域名屬于域名列表時(shí),獲取所述域名對(duì)應(yīng)的IP地址;
處理模塊,用于將所述IP地址加入到當(dāng)前路由表中形成目標(biāo)路由表;
第二獲取模塊,用于對(duì)所述目標(biāo)路由表進(jìn)行流量調(diào)度處理,獲得所述IP地址對(duì)應(yīng)的路由。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于小米科技有限責(zé)任公司,未經(jīng)小米科技有限責(zé)任公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310474001.5/2.html,轉(zhuǎn)載請(qǐng)聲明來源鉆瓜專利網(wǎng)。
- 旅游車輛調(diào)度監(jiān)控方法及其系統(tǒng)
- 一種用戶隊(duì)列調(diào)度的方法和裝置
- 一種資源調(diào)度的方法、裝置和過濾式調(diào)度器
- 一種調(diào)度方法和裝置
- 一種調(diào)度終端動(dòng)態(tài)切換調(diào)度組歸屬關(guān)系的方法及裝置
- 用戶調(diào)度方法、裝置、基站和存儲(chǔ)介質(zhì)
- 一種食材的調(diào)度系統(tǒng)和方法
- 一種資源調(diào)度的方法、裝置和過濾式調(diào)度器
- 任務(wù)調(diào)度方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)
- 一種自動(dòng)化調(diào)度系統(tǒng)和調(diào)度方法
- 一種數(shù)據(jù)庫(kù)讀寫分離的方法和裝置
- 一種手機(jī)動(dòng)漫人物及背景創(chuàng)作方法
- 一種通訊綜合測(cè)試終端的測(cè)試方法
- 一種服裝用人體測(cè)量基準(zhǔn)點(diǎn)的獲取方法
- 系統(tǒng)升級(jí)方法及裝置
- 用于虛擬和接口方法調(diào)用的裝置和方法
- 線程狀態(tài)監(jiān)控方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 一種JAVA智能卡及其虛擬機(jī)組件優(yōu)化方法
- 檢測(cè)程序中方法耗時(shí)的方法、裝置及存儲(chǔ)介質(zhì)
- 函數(shù)的執(zhí)行方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)





